Wow, Facebook is providing some RSS feeds. It’s opening up a little bit and many people applaud the effort. And yes, it’s cool to have them. There are feeds for notifications, posted items by friends, status updates, and maybe some more. I can subscribe to them and read them in my feed reader without visiting Facebook. Fine.
But is this a reason to become all excited about it? Isn’t Facebook a silo anymore? I think it still is. Exporting my contacts? No way. Importing them? Nope. Don’t get me wrong, though. Facebook has come a long way from a social network for students which required an email address with an .edu domain to the network it is today. But it is not open.
